Global Nanotechnology in Packaging Market Forecast 2035:

According to the report, the global nanotechnology in packaging market is projected to expand from USD 24.7 billion in 2025 to USD 88.4 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 13.6%, the highest during the forecast period. The nanotechnology in packaging market is experiencing a tremendous growth in the world due to the growing complexity of the current supply chain and the value of goods transported. Nano-enhanced packaging of the fragile electronics, high-value pharmaceutical goods and specialty food products are increasing as companies are aiming to reduce transit losses and product degradation during multi-modal distribution channels.

Manufacturers are concentrating on precision engineered nanocoatings, ultra-thin multi-functional films and hybrid composite materials to enhance durability, thermal resistant materials as well as barrier performance. Real-time quality control and automated material management is now being integrated to improve efficiency in production and minimize variability in operations and material waste.

Sustainability is also becoming one of the critical strategic considerations and companies have been looking into recyclable nano-films, biodegradable nanocomposites as well as energy efficient production processes. The investments in local manufacturing centres and joint innovations with research institutes allow penetrating the market more quickly, adapting to the unique needs of the regions, and gaining brand loyalty over the long term.

“Key Driver, Restraint, and Growth Opportunity Shaping the Global Nanotechnology in Packaging Market”

The most significant force in the market is the increasing demand of intelligent and functional packaging which prolongs the shelf life of products and active monitoring of the products. Nanotech provides an opportunity to add nanosensors, oxygen and moisture scavengers, antimicrobial nanocoatings, which will improve the stability, safety, and quality of products. This is particularly important in high-value pharmaceuticals, perishable foods and temperature-sensitive nutraceuticals and has led to an increased rate of adoption in global supply chains.

Nano-enabled packaging has high costs in terms of R&D and commercialization which restricts a wider market penetration. The creation of scalable, reproducible nano-coatings and incorporation of sensors necessities advanced material engineering, accurate manufacturing controls and compliance with rigid regulatory requirements. Secondly, there is a shortage of qualified manpower and dynamic safety laws on nanomaterials that are challenging to operate and comply, especially to small and medium manufacturers.

The creation of multifunctional and environmentally friendly nano-packaging is a major opportunity. Recyclable, biodegradable, and bio-based nanomaterials could be reconstructed to be in line with the principles of the circular economy without compromising barrier functionality. Brand protection, consumer trust, and adoption in high-end and new markets all over the globe can also be improved with further integration with blockchain-based traceability, real-time freshness indicators, and IoT-based monitoring of the supply chain. 

Expansion of Global Nanotechnology in Packaging Market

“Growth Driven by Advanced Material Commercialization and Functional Packaging Intelligence”  

  • Market are growing because the commercialization of superior nanomaterials like nano-clays, nano-silver, and graphene-based coating is occurring. The materials permit extremely thin barriers, antimicrobial, and control of gas permeability resulting in high functional performance and a reduction in material consumption by manufacturers. The efficiency will sustain widespread use in the cost-sensitive and high-end packing format.
  • The combination of nano-enabled responsive and sensory packaging systems is proving to generate new growth opportunities. The use of packaging that can track freshness, microbial activity, oxygen entry, and temperature fluctuations is on the increase, especially in the food, pharmaceuticals and high-value consumer goods supply chains. This movement is improving the integrity of the product, customer safety, and the brand trust.
  • Market expansion is also being increased by innovations that are driven by sustainability. The bio-compatible nanomaterials research, compostable nano-barriers, and low-toxicity nano-additives are helpful in terms of recyclability and regulatory compliance. When nanotechnology development is aligned on the goals of a circular economy, manufacturers are expanding their adoption on a wide range of end-use applications without violating the standards of environmental and policies.

Regional Analysis of Global Nanotechnology in Packaging Market

  • The Asia pacific leads the nanotechnology in packaging market propelled by the high rate of commercialization of nano-enabled mass packaging of high-volume consumer products and pharmaceutical distribution in the region. The concentration of large-scale contract packers and vertically integrated producers of FMCGs is allowing the rapid implementation of nano-coating, oxygen scavengers, and moisture-control nanolayers in an industrial context. The presence of strong cost-to-performance benefits, localized production of nanomaterials, and localized production of equipments are structurally enhancing the leadership of Asia Pacific in terms of high-volume adoption of nano-packaging.
  • North America is the region with the highest growth rate, which is backed by the increase in high-value nano-enabled packaging to guarantee accurate food safety, biologics protection, and control of pharmaceutical integrity. Nanosensors, time-temperature sensors and antimicrobial nanofilms are being quickly adopted in the region in regulated packaging environments. It is growing over through vigorous commercialization of laboratory-scale nanotech into high-end packaging markets, university-industry partnership, IP-supported innovation savories, and large-margin specialty packaging markets.
